Holland on Sea Baptist Church - Church Hall

Terms and Conditions of Hire

The church hall is managed and maintained by the diaconate of Holland on Sea Baptist Church.  Contact details for the appropriate Deacons, who may need to be contacted, will be distributed to the hirer at the time of booking.

The hirer, either as an individual or a named contact and representative or a group, is ultimately responsible that the terms and conditions are followed. If the terms and conditions of use are breached the diaconate reserves the right to terminate the hire of the hall with immediate effect.

  1. Hire of the Church hall includes the use of the hall and the adjoining kitchen, small hall, Room 2; access through the lobby area and the use of the toilets.  The car park adjacent to the hall may also be used but vehicles are left in the car park at the owner's risk
  2. The hirer is responsible for any accidents, injuries or death and also for any damage to the church premises (interior or exterior) caused either by them or any person attending the function for which the hire is made.  The diaconate would expect the hirer to arrange independent insurance and may request to see proof of such insurance cover.  (It is expected that regular users have Public Liability Insurance with a minimum limit of indemnity of £2,000,000).
  3. The hall should be found clean and tidy at the beginning of each hire session.  If it is not so, please inform the ministry deacon.
  4. The hirer should ensure that the floor is swept and that the kitchen, tables, trolleys and toilets are in a clean condition and that the hall is tidy.  In short, please leave the hall as you would expect to find it.
  5. It is the responsibility of the hirer to take all their rubbish away with them.
  6. The kitchen and equipment, including cutlery and crockery, may be used for the providing of lightr refreshments.  Anything used must be washed and put away.  It is the responsibility of the hirer to provide tea towels and dish clothes.  Food must not be prepared in the kitchen or the usage of the dishwasher without the written permission of the diaconate.
  7. Hirer's should not affix anything to the walls of the hall.  If regular users wish to display a poster or notice on one of the notice boards permission must be sought from either the diaconate or the minister.
  8. The church hall is not licensed therefore alcohol cannot be sold on the premises nor may alcohol be consumed on the premises.  Also due to licensing laws the hall cannot be used for the projection of commercial films or DVD presentations.  The church can permit the usage of its audio system upon the permission of the diaconate.
  9. The hirer shall ensure that there is no rowdy or unseemly behaviour by any person attending the function for which the hire has been made.
  10. Any breakages shall either be replaced or the church reimbursed, likewise the hirer will be liable for any damage to the church premises.
  11. The main hall is hired on an hourly rate of £15 per hour.  Payment will be invoiced by the church treasurer.
